Key facts from Starlight Estates's documents

Collections & liens
Oregon: Architectural Control Committee can levy charges and if not paid in 15 days, sum becomes a lien. Texas: no specific lien process for violations, but enforcement by legal proceedings. (Oregon Article III Section 3: 'Such sums)
Pets
Yes, reasonable number of household pets. Oregon: 'reasonable number of household pets, which are not kept, bred, or raised for commercial purposes and are not a nuisance'. Texas: traditional domestic animals only, no non-traditional pets. (Oregon Section 3b (uses prohibited) exce)
Leasing & rentals
Oregon: not addressed. Texas Unit 6: leasing of residence allowed (explicitly not considered a business). Texas Unit 5: not addressed; Texas Unit 3: not addressed. (Texas Unit 6 Article II Section 1: 'Leas)
Parking & vehicles
Not specifically addressed; Texas prohibits inoperative vehicles on street for more than 7 days. (Texas Unit 6: 'No inoperative boat, bus,)
Fences
Oregon: no chain-link or metal; cedar fences max 6 ft; front fences max 3 ft with horizontal bracings; side/rear fences jointly maintained. Texas: no fence nearer front lot line than building setback; max 6 ft; no chain-link, hurricane, met (Oregon Section 8; Texas Unit 6 Article I)
Architectural approval
Oregon: plans must be submitted at least 30 days in advance; if committee fails to act within 30 days, consent deemed given. Consent revoked after 1 year if not commenced. Texas: not specified. (Oregon Section 5a, 5b, 5c: 'submitted at)
Home business
Oregon: Not addressed; Texas Unit 6: allowed with restrictions (no customers visiting, no signage, no door-to-door solicitation, etc.). Texas Unit 5 and 3: not permitted (no commercial activity at all). (Texas Unit 6 Article II Section 1: 'Owne)
Signs & flags
Oregon: not addressed (except maybe through ACC). Texas: only one professional sign (max 5 sq ft) for sale; builder model homes allowed 4x4 sign; political signs allowed with restrictions; no other signs. (Texas Unit 6 Article II Section 6; Texas)
Setbacks / home size
Oregon: not specified (but ACC approval considers location). Texas: front setback per plat; interior side setback at least 5 ft from interior lot line; corner lot side setbacks per plat; rear setback per city code. (Texas Unit 6 Article III Section 5; Texa)
Maintenance
Oregon: each owner maintains lot and improvements. Texas: owner responsible for upkeep of lot and improvements, and area between pavement and lot line. (Oregon Article II Section 3; Texas Unit )
Use restrictions
Yes, all documents require single-family residential use. Texas documents allow home businesses under strict conditions. (Oregon: implied by restrictions; Texas U)
Voting & meetings
Oregon: 51% of owners can adopt, amend, or repeal CC&Rs after subdivision 100% built. Texas Unit 6: 75% of Owners can amend; Texas Unit 5: majority of lots can amend; Texas Unit 3: majority of lots (similar). (Oregon Section 4: 'A vote of 51% of the )
